On multi-node GICv4.1 system, VSGI senders always use one certain 4_1 ITS,
because find_4_1_its() returns the first its_node in the list, regardless of
which node the VSGI sender is on. This brings guest VSGI performance drop
when VM is not running on the same node as this returned ITS.
On a 2-socket environment, each with one ITS and 32 cpu, GICv4.1 enabled,
4U8G guest, 4 vcpu is running on same socket.
When the VM is on socket0, kvm-unit-tests ipi_hw result is 850ns.
When the VM is on socket1, it is 750ns.
The reason is that the VSGI sender always uses the last reported ITS (that
on socket1) to inject VSGI. The access from a CPU to a other-socket ITS
will cost 100ns more compared to an access to the local ITS.
Using the local ITS results in a 12% reduction in IPI latency.
Modify find_4_1_its() to return the first per-CPU local_4_1_its, which is
initialized when the VPE table is inherited from the ITS or from another
CPU. If it fails to find a local 4_1 ITS, it returns any 4_1 ITS like
before.

The driver only offloads neighbors that are constructed on top of net
devices registered by it or their uppers (which are all Ethernet). The
device supports GRE encapsulation and decapsulation of forwarded
traffic, but the driver will not offload dummy neighbors constructed on
top of GRE net devices as they are not uppers of its net devices:
# ip link add name gre1 up type gre tos inherit local 192.0.2.1 remote 198.51.100.1
# ip neigh add 0.0.0.0 lladdr 0.0.0.0 nud noarp dev gre1
$ ip neigh show dev gre1 nud noarp
0.0.0.0 lladdr 0.0.0.0 NOARP
(Note that the neighbor is not marked with 'offload')
When the driver is reloaded and the existing configuration is replayed,
the driver does not perform the same check regarding existing neighbors
and offloads the previously added one:
# devlink dev reload pci/0000:01:00.0
$ ip neigh show dev gre1 nud noarp
0.0.0.0 lladdr 0.0.0.0 offload NOARP
If the neighbor is later deleted, the driver will ignore the
notification (given the GRE net device is not its upper) and will
therefore keep referencing freed memory, resulting in a use-after-free
[1] when the net device is deleted:
# ip neigh del 0.0.0.0 lladdr 0.0.0.0 dev gre1
# ip link del dev gre1
Fix by skipping neighbor replay if the net device for which the replay
is performed is not our upper.

When starting the local sync timer to synchronize the state of a remote
CPU it should be added on the CPU to be synchronized, not the initiating
CPU. This results in interrupt delivery being delayed until the timer
eventually runs (due to another mask/unmask/migrate operation) on the
target CPU.

Since commit 58d9a38f6fac ("PCI: Skip attaching driver in device_add()"),
PCI enumeration is split into two steps: In the first step, all devices
are published in sysfs with device_add(). In the second step, drivers are
bound to the devices with device_attach(). To delay driver binding until
the second step, a "bool match_driver" in struct pci_dev is used.
Instead of a bool, use a bit in the "unsigned long priv_flags" to shrink
struct pci_dev a little and prevent use of the bool outside the PCI core
(as has happened with commit cbbc00be2ce3 ("iommu/amd: Prevent binding
other PCI drivers to IOMMU PCI devices")).

Commit 991de2e59090 ("PCI, x86: Implement pcibios_alloc_irq() and
pcibios_free_irq()") changed IRQ handling on PCI driver probing.
It inadvertently broke resume from system sleep on AMD platforms:
https://lore.kernel.org/r/20150926164651.GA3640@pd.tnic/
This was fixed by two independent commits:
* 8affb487d4a4 ("x86/PCI: Don't alloc pcibios-irq when MSI is enabled")
* cbbc00be2ce3 ("iommu/amd: Prevent binding other PCI drivers to IOMMU PCI devices")
The breaking change and one of these two fixes were subsequently reverted:
* fe25d078874f ("Revert "x86/PCI: Don't alloc pcibios-irq when MSI is enabled"")
* 6c777e8799a9 ("Revert "PCI, x86: Implement pcibios_alloc_irq() and pcibios_free_irq()"")
This rendered the second fix unnecessary, so revert it as well. It used
the match_driver flag in struct pci_dev, which is internal to the PCI core
and not supposed to be touched by arbitrary drivers.

Currently, users need detailed hardware information to understand the
scope of controls within each uncore domain. Uncore frequency controls
manage subsystems such as core, cache, memory, and I/O. The UFS TPMI
provides this information, which can be used to present the scope more
clearly.
Each uncore domain consists of one or more agent types, with each agent
type controlling one or more uncore hardware subsystems. For example, a
single agent might control both the core and cache.
Introduce a new attribute called "agent_types." This attribute displays
a list of agents, separated by space character.
The string representations for agent types are as follows:
For core agent: core
For cache agent: cache
For memory agent: memory
For I/O agent: io
These agent types are read during probe time for each cluster and stored
as part of the struct uncore_data.

Depending on the data offset, skb_to_sgvec_nomark() may use
less scatterlist elements than what was forecasted by the
previous call to skb_cow_data().
It specifically happens when 'skbheadlen(skb) < offset', because
in this case we entirely skip the skb's head, which would have
required its own scatterlist element.
For this reason, it doesn't make sense to check that
skb_to_sgvec_nomark() returns the same value as skb_cow_data(),
but we can rather check for errors only, as it happens in
other parts of the kernel.

ndo_start_xmit is basically expected to always return NETDEV_TX_OK.
However, in case of error, it was currently returning NET_XMIT_DROP,
which is not a valid netdev_tx_t return value, leading to
misinterpretation.
Change ndo_start_xmit to always return NETDEV_TX_OK to signal back
to the caller that the packet was handled (even if dropped).
Effects of this bug can be seen when sending IPv6 packets having
no peer to forward them to:

When routing a packet to a LAN behind a peer, ovpn needs to
inspect the route entry that brought the packet there in the
first place.
If this packet is truly routable, the route entry provides the
GW to be used when looking up the VPN peer to send the packet to.
However, the route entry is currently dropped before entering
the ovpn xmit function, because the IFF_XMIT_DST_RELEASE priv_flag
is enabled by default.
Clear the IFF_XMIT_DST_RELEASE flag during interface setup to allow
the route entry (skb's dst) to survive and thus be inspected
by the ovpn routing logic.

IPv6 user packets (sent over the tunnel) may be larger than
the outgoing interface MTU after encapsulation.
When this happens ovpn should allow the kernel to fragment
them because they are "locally generated".
To achieve the above, we must set skb->ignore_df = 1
so that ip6_fragment() can be made aware of this decision.
Failing to do so will result in ip6_fragment() dropping
the packet thinking it was "routed".
No change is required in the IPv4 path, because when
calling udp_tunnel_xmit_skb() we already pass the
'df' argument set to 0, therefore the resulting datagram
is allowed to be fragmented if need be.

According to the I3C specification, address arbitration only happens during
the START. Repeated START do not initiate arbitration, and In-Band
Interrupts (IBIs) cannot occur at this stage.
Resending the address upon a NACK in a repeat START is therefore redundant
and unnecessary. Avoid redundant retries, improving efficiency and ensuring
protocol compliance.

Moving the job from workqueue to ISR for two reasons.
1. Improve bus utilization.
If the requests are postponed to be received in the workqueue thread,
the SDA line remains low for a long time while the system loading is
high. During this period, the bus is not available for other targets
to raise requests.
2. Ensure prompt response to requests.
For timing-critical requests, the target may encouter a failure or the
event is missed if the request is not received in time.
IBI request is short, ISR can receive the data quickly and then queue a
work to handle it in the bottom half.

Since MIPI I3C HCI specification version v0.8 INTR_STATUS bits 9:0 are
reserved. Version v0.5 has bits 9 and 5:0 in use but not handled by the
current driver code and not needed in DMA transfers.
PIO transfers with v0.5 would require changes to both
core.c: i3c_hci_irq_handler() and pio.c: hci_pio_irq_handler() though.
For these reasons don't enable signal updates from INTR_STATUS bits 9:0.
It allow to get rid of "unexpected INTR_STATUS" error messages on old
v0.5 IP version and is a no-op for later versions starting from v0.8.
